This is one of the details that I got to do over the weekend. Time & money was an issue with this job, and the customer wasn't overly obsessed with removing all the swirls on the finish. They just wanted it shined up a little. Sounded like the perfect job for Poli-Seal. Here was my process:
Wash:
Optimum Wash with white/yellow Schmitt
Pre-soaked grill/windshield with PB Bug Squash (3:1)
Clay:
DP clay with Pinnacle lube
Polish/Wax:
Optmium Poli-Seal with white LC pad -Speed 5 on PC
Wheels/Tires:
DP wheel and tire gel
Wheel wells with Simple Green
Dressed with Meg's Hot Shine
Engine:
DP engine degreaser with Meg's brush
Dressed with Meg's Hot Shine Tire Spray
Interior:
Vac'd and dressed with 303
